class TencentCloud::Live::V20180801::ModifyLiveRecordTemplateRequest

ModifyLiveRecordTemplate请求参数结构体

def deserialize(params)

def deserialize(params)
  @TemplateId = params['TemplateId']
  @TemplateName = params['TemplateName']
  @Description = params['Description']
  unless params['FlvParam'].nil?
    @FlvParam = RecordParam.new
    @FlvParam.deserialize(params['FlvParam'])
  end
  unless params['HlsParam'].nil?
    @HlsParam = RecordParam.new
    @HlsParam.deserialize(params['HlsParam'])
  end
  unless params['Mp4Param'].nil?
    @Mp4Param = RecordParam.new
    @Mp4Param.deserialize(params['Mp4Param'])
  end
  unless params['AacParam'].nil?
    @AacParam = RecordParam.new
    @AacParam.deserialize(params['AacParam'])
  end
  unless params['HlsSpecialParam'].nil?
    @HlsSpecialParam = HlsSpecialParam.new
    @HlsSpecialParam.deserialize(params['HlsSpecialParam'])
  end
  unless params['Mp3Param'].nil?
    @Mp3Param = RecordParam.new
    @Mp3Param.deserialize(params['Mp3Param'])
  end
  @RemoveWatermark = params['RemoveWatermark']
  unless params['FlvSpecialParam'].nil?
    @FlvSpecialParam = FlvSpecialParam.new
    @FlvSpecialParam.deserialize(params['FlvSpecialParam'])
  end
end

def initialize(templateid=nil, templatename=nil, description=nil, flvparam=nil, hlsparam=nil, mp4param=nil, aacparam=nil, hlsspecialparam=nil, mp3param=nil, removewatermark=nil, flvspecialparam=nil)

def initialize(templateid=nil, templatename=nil, description=nil, flvparam=nil, hlsparam=nil, mp4param=nil, aacparam=nil, hlsspecialparam=nil, mp3param=nil, removewatermark=nil, flvspecialparam=nil)
  @TemplateId = templateid
  @TemplateName = templatename
  @Description = description
  @FlvParam = flvparam
  @HlsParam = hlsparam
  @Mp4Param = mp4param
  @AacParam = aacparam
  @HlsSpecialParam = hlsspecialparam
  @Mp3Param = mp3param
  @RemoveWatermark = removewatermark
  @FlvSpecialParam = flvspecialparam
end